The influence of chronic Helicobacter pylori infection in serum lipoprotein associated phospholipase A2 level and stability of atherosclerotic plaques in patients with carotid atherosclerosis / 中国医师杂志

ABSTRACT
Objective To explore the influence of Helicobacter pylori (Hp) infection in serum lipoprotein associated phospholipase A2 (Lp-PLA2), carotid intima-media thickness and stability of atherosclerotic plaques in atherosclerosis patients.Methods A total of 393 cases of patients with carotid artery arteriosclerosis confirmed by carotid color uhrasonography, who are informed consent, was selected as objects.The14C urea breath test was used to determine the infection situation of selected objects of helicobacter pylori.Meanwhile, enzyme-linked immunosorbent assay (ELISA) was used to determine the level of serum lipoprotein associated phospholipase A2 (Lp-PLA2).Results Serum Lp-PLA2 levels and carotid intimamedia thickness (IMT) of patients with carotid artery atherosclerosis in Hp infection group were higher than that of Hp non-infection group, and with the degree of Hp infection aggravating in the patients of carotid artery atherosclerosis, their serum Lp-PLA2 levels and carotid IMT were also increased accordingly.F test showed that the differences of serum Lp-PLA2 levels and carotid IMT in different degree of carotid artery atherosclerosis group were statistically significant (P <0.01).The incidence of unstable plaque of Hp infection group was obviously higher than that of the Hp non-infection group in the carotid atherosclerosis with plaques with statistical significance (chi square value =4.744, P =0.029).Multivariate linear regression analysis showed that the possibility of complication of unstable plaques in Hp infection group of carotid artery atherosclerosis was 1.82 times than that of non-infection group.With serum Lp-PLA2 every increasing 1 μg/L, the possibility of instability plaque increased by 2%.Conclusions Hp infection may promote the occurrence and development of carotid artery atherosclerosis by increasing serum level of Lp-PLA2 and changing the stability of atherosclerotic plaques.
